色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ql字符串長度函數length

夏志豪2年前10瀏覽0評論

MySQL提供了許多用于處理字符串的函數,其中一個很常用的函數是length函數。length函數用于返回字符串的長度,這在許多場景下都是很有用的。

SELECT length('hello, world!'); 
-- 輸出:13

以上代碼中,length函數對參數'hello, world!'進行計算,返回它的長度13。這個例子很簡單,但是在實際應用中,我們經常需要計算字符串的長度。

需要注意的是,length函數只能計算ASCII碼的長度,如果字符串中包含Unicode字符,那么它的長度可能會與我們期望的不一致。

SELECT length('你好,世界'); 
-- 輸出:12

以上代碼中,'你好,世界'這個字符串包含了中文字符,它的長度并不是我們預期的6,而是12。這是因為中文字符是Unicode字符,一個中文字符由兩個ASCII碼組成。

在實際應用中,我們要根據具體的情況來判斷何時使用length函數,當字符串中包含Unicode字符時,我們需要使用其他函數來計算字符串的長度。